Seeking a better urban future

Speaker: Dr Cheong Koon Hean, the Institute of Policy Studies' 5th S R Nathan Fellow, CEO of the Housing and Development Board 6 Dec 2018

Dr Cheong Koon Hean, the Institute of Policy Studies' 5th S R Nathan Fellow, CEO of the Housing and Development Board, at the book launch of “Seeking a better urban future” provided her views on how cities deal with their urban challenges to create better life for their citizens. Dr Cheong also shared some of the considerations needed to plan and develop Singapore in the face of rapid change and uncertainty, given our constraints as a small city-state with an open economy.
